Evolution is a universal process from "summary" of The Evolution of Everything by Matt Ridley
Evolution is not just a biological process; it is a universal phenomenon that governs the development of everything in the world. From technology to culture, from language to economics, evolution shapes all aspects of our lives. Just as species evolve to adapt to their environment, ideas and institutions evolve to fit the needs of society.
This concept of evolution as a universal process challenges the traditional view that change is guided by a central intelligence or design. Instead, it suggests that change emerges from the bottom up, through a process of trial and error. This decentralized model of evolution is more in line with the principles of complexity theory, which emphasizes the importance of self-organization and emergence in systems.
